The VRA is a small VM deployed by Zerto on each ESXi host. It intercepts writes at the hypervisor level and replicates them to the recovery site in near real-time.
Key points
- One VRA is needed per ESXi host that has protected VMs on it
- If a VM migrates to a host without a VRA, replication will fail
- VRAs are managed through the ZVM (Zerto Virtual Manager)
Troubleshooting
If a VPG shows errors, check:
- What ESXi host the VM is on (via vSphere)
- Whether that host has a VRA installed (check ZVM → Setup)
- If a VRA is missing, it needs to be deployed on that host
